Abstract
In this paper, effect of acetate ions on cadmium solvent extraction with di-2-ethyl hexyl phosphoric acid, D2EHPA, in kerosene as diluent has been investigated. Infrared spectroscopy and slope analysis methods were used to determine metal–organic complex and reaction stoichiometry respectively. Results showed that acetate ions did not participate in the complex formation but acted as a buffering agent. It was found that acetate could greatly improve the extraction yield. Maximum distribution coefficients were observed in the presence of 0.05 to 0.25 M acetate corresponding to the equilibrium pH of 4.14 to 4.70. The mechanism of cadmium extraction from acetate solution can be represented at equilibrium by: Cd2 + + 2(H2A2)org ↔ (CdA2(HA)2)org + 2H+.
